💡
原文英文,约900词,阅读约需4分钟。
📝
内容提要
本文介绍了在Kubernetes中部署PostgreSQL的关键要素,包括持久存储、网络安全、配置管理和密码保护。通过创建PVC、网络策略、ConfigMap、Secret、StatefulSet和Service,确保数据库的安全与稳定运行。
🎯
关键要点
- 在Kubernetes中部署PostgreSQL需要持久存储、网络安全、配置管理和密码保护。
- 创建PersistentVolumeClaim(PVC)以确保PostgreSQL的数据安全存储。
- 通过NetworkPolicy创建网络策略,保护PostgreSQL免受黑客攻击。
- 使用ConfigMap配置PostgreSQL的数据库和用户信息。
- 通过Secret存储PostgreSQL的密码,确保其安全性。
- 使用StatefulSet创建PostgreSQL的实例,确保其状态持久化。
- 通过Service为PostgreSQL提供访问入口,允许其他应用与其通信。
❓
延伸问答
在Kubernetes中部署PostgreSQL需要哪些关键要素?
需要持久存储、网络安全、配置管理和密码保护。
如何确保PostgreSQL的数据安全存储?
通过创建PersistentVolumeClaim(PVC)来确保数据安全存储。
如何保护PostgreSQL免受黑客攻击?
通过创建NetworkPolicy来设置网络策略,限制访问权限。
如何配置PostgreSQL的数据库和用户信息?
使用ConfigMap来配置数据库和用户信息。
如何安全地存储PostgreSQL的密码?
通过创建Secret来存储密码,确保其安全性。
StatefulSet在PostgreSQL部署中有什么作用?
StatefulSet用于创建PostgreSQL的实例,确保其状态持久化。
如何为PostgreSQL提供访问入口?
通过创建Service来为PostgreSQL提供访问入口,允许其他应用与其通信。
🏷️
标签
➡️